Smoke Detectors, A Gift to Save a Life

Check your smoke detectors. (Install new batteries).

Check your electrical cords to insure it's not damaged. Insure they are ULC/CSA approved.

Do not overload circuits with electric decorations.

Keep your wood stove/furnace area free of clutter such as card board/wrapping paper.

Check your chimney. Make sure it is clean. Chimney sweeps are at the fire
hall.

Do not leave burning (lit) candles or any open flame unattended in your home.

It has come to the council's attention that a dog was recently caught in a leg hold trap near the Community (within the Municipal Plan). It is therefore, strongly recommended not to trap in areas close by the community where incidents such as this could happen.

In order to avoid a situation such as this, it is strongly recommended that pet owners also take the responsibility of ensuring that their pets are supervised at all times.
